## Tuning: Flaky Integration Tests

The Coppergate payments service has a handful of integration tests that fail intermittently due to settlement-simulator timing. Rather than disable them, we retry with backoff and quarantine tests that exceed the failure budget. Support should not re-enable quarantined tests without checking recent run history first. Adjusting these values changes both CI duration and flake tolerance, so coordinate changes with the Harwick team. The current settings are below.

tuning constants:
QUOTAS = {
    "druwyn": 5,
    "holix": 5,
    "zorath": 5,
    "holwyn": 10,
}

14:22 — Offline sync regression confirmed (Terrapath field-survey app)

At 14:22 the on-call engineer reproduced the data-loss path: surveys saved while offline were marked synced once connectivity returned, even when the upload was rejected. The queue flush skipped the server acknowledgement check introduced in the previous sprint. Release manager note: the fix must ship before the coastal survey season. The offending build is identified by the token recorded below.

session token of kawif-fawig = htk31_f3f599be2b1a34affb1efa8d0feccf8

Step 4: Enable the thumbnail queue. Once the Pixelforge workers are deployed, the resizer service on Harlow Cloud will start pulling jobs from the thumbgen queue automatically. Verify queue depth stays below 500 before proceeding. If jobs stall, restart the worker pool rather than the broker. The workers authenticate to the queue broker with a shared token, so add the following line to the env file now.

vault entry, yahaf-tagug: LEDGER_TOKEN20=884d77d1a8b98aa4edfb